Understanding Veterans Discounts in the Hospitality Industry
Veterans discounts are special rates provided by hotels as a token of appreciation for military service. These discounts often range from a percentage off the standard rate to exclusive offers tailored for veterans and active-duty military personnel. While not all hotels offer discounts, many recognize the importance of supporting those who have served and their families.
Typically, to qualify for a veterans discount, individuals need to present valid military identification or documentation such as a veteran ID card, DD214, or other official proof of service. It is advisable to inquire about available discounts during the booking process or at check-in to ensure eligibility and to understand any specific requirements.
Major Hotel Chains Offering Veterans Discounts
Several prominent hotel chains have established policies and programs dedicated to providing discounts for veterans. Here’s a detailed look at some of the most widely recognized options:
1. Marriott International
Marriott is known for its strong support of military personnel and veterans. They offer a dedicated program called Marriott Military & Veteran Discount which provides special rates for active military, veterans, and their families. To access these discounts, travelers can book directly through Marriott’s official website or contact customer service, verifying their military status with valid documentation.
2. Hilton Hotels & Resorts
Hilton has a longstanding commitment to honoring military service. They offer discounts for active duty military, veterans, and retired personnel. Hilton’s program often includes exclusive rates and benefits, and eligible guests can verify their status during booking or at check-in with military ID.
3. Hyatt Hotels
Hyatt provides special rates for veterans and active military members. They have a dedicated Military & Veterans Rate that can be accessed through their official booking channels. Hyatt also participates in various veteran support programs, making travel more affordable for those who have served.
4. Best Western Hotels & Resorts
Best Western offers military discounts to active duty and retired military personnel. Their rates are available through their website or by calling their reservation center, with valid military identification required upon check-in.
5. Holiday Inn & IHG Hotels
InterContinental Hotels Group (IHG), which owns Holiday Inn, offers special rates for military personnel, including veterans. These discounts can be accessed online or through IHG’s customer service, with proof of military service at check-in.
6. Wyndham Hotels & Resorts
Wyndham provides discounts for military members, including veterans. Their rates are often available through their official website, and verification of military status may be required during check-in.
7. Choice Hotels
Choice Hotels, including brands like Comfort Inn, Quality Inn, and Clarion, offers military discounts for eligible guests. These can be booked online or by phone, with military ID needed at check-in.
8. Radisson Hotel Group
Radisson offers military discounts across many of their properties worldwide. Travelers can access these rates through Radisson’s official booking platform or by contacting customer service with proof of service.
Specialized Programs and Initiatives Supporting Veterans
Beyond individual hotel discounts, many hotel chains participate in broader initiatives aimed at supporting veterans and active military personnel:
- Veterans Advantage: A membership program offering discounts across various travel and retail sectors, including hotels.
- Military Discount Websites: Platforms like Military.com or GovX compile verified discounts available at participating hotels.
- Partnerships with Veteran Organizations: Some hotel chains partner with organizations such as the Wounded Warrior Project or the USO to offer special rates and packages.
How to Access and Maximize Veterans Hotel Discounts
To effectively utilize veterans discounts, consider the following tips:
- Book Directly Through Hotel Websites: Many hotels offer the best rates and discounts when booking directly on their official sites, where verification is straightforward.
- Use Verified Discount Platforms: Websites like Military.com, GovX, or the hotel’s dedicated veteran programs ensure discounts are legitimate and up-to-date.
- Have Valid Documentation Ready: Always carry military ID, veteran ID card, or other proof of service to present during check-in.
- Inquire at the Front Desk: Even if you don’t see a discount listed online, ask about veteran rates during check-in; some offers are not advertised widely.
- Plan Ahead: Popular hotels with veteran discounts can fill up quickly during peak travel seasons, so booking in advance is advisable.
- Compare Rates: Don’t hesitate to compare different hotels and booking platforms to find the best deal available.
